EDB, UK Promote DCTS Export Opportunities

The Sri Lanka Export Development Board, in partnership with the British High Commission Colombo, conducted a hybrid awareness session on 11 February 2026 to help exporters capitalize on the United Kingdom’s Developing Countries Trading Scheme (DCTS).

Nearly 200 exporters and stakeholders participated physically and via Zoom. EDB Chairman Mangala Wijesinghe highlighted the UK’s importance as a key export destination and stressed the benefits of simplified procedures and tariff preferences under DCTS.

The main presentation by Ellie Parker from the UK’s Foreign, Commonwealth and Development Office detailed recent improvements, eligibility criteria, and practical steps for claiming tariff concessions.

An interactive Q&A clarified compliance requirements and rules of origin. EDB Acting Director General E. L. K. Dissanayake reaffirmed continued institutional support to strengthen Sri Lanka’s export competitiveness and better utilize emerging trade opportunities in the UK market.
